Disney Channel’s “Andi Mack,” a comedy that shows the ongoing drama of a young girl, recently got renewed for its second season. And star Asher Angel, who portrays Jonah Beck, the crush of the titular character Andi (Peyton Elizabeth Lee), spoke with The Park Recordabout his experiences with the show.
Asher said he can relate to his character, which means he often acts like himself with the role.
“Sometimes it’s funny because everything that happens in our script sometimes follows what happens in real life,” he said.
